    Book Review

Reviewed by Kerliza Foon for Readers' Favorite

Welcome to Mystic's carnival, where there is more here than meets the eye, where witches and wizards are hiding in plain sight and where the more you look, the more there is to discover. Debra Kristi's Moorigad takes you on a journey into this delightful carnival where the paranormal thrive. Meet Sebastian, a half Grim Reaper, and Mara (something like the sirens in Greek mythology), who works as a tarot card reader. He's your average moody teenager who is running from a family legacy. Then there's Kyra, a hybrid dragon of fire and water, known as a Moorigad, who is also running from her family's pressure when she stumbles onto Mystic's carnival. Together these two become best friends and work together at the carnival, in hopes of finding a place where they belong. It all seems to be fine until their families start meddling. But it's not just their families they have to worry about. Evil forces are at work, trying to destroy their relationship and completely obliterate Kyra's family. Can Kyra make the right choices?

Debra Kristi wove a magnetic tale filled with best friends, family drama and magic. I fell in love with Sebastian and Kyra, especially when they constantly tried to show their good intentions toward each other. They were brought to life with creative flair and boldly struggled to live their lives. While it takes a bit to jump in at the beginning, once you have joined them in Mystic's carnival, the magic has already pulled you into the story. You are in for a fantastical, magical ride and, for those who love paranormal books, this one is for you. I loved it.
